Vases come in a wide variety of shapes, sizes, and styles, each serving a specific purpose. For example bud vases are small, narrow vases which are designed to hold a single flower or a few stems. They are perfect for creating simple yet elegant floral arrangements and are often used as centrepieces or to add a pop of colour to a side table or windowsill.

Characterized by their cylindrical shape and straight sides, cylinder vases are versatile and can accommodate different types of floral arrangements. They are often used for creating modern and minimalist displays.

Trumpet vases have a flared opening and a narrow base, resembling the shape of a trumpet. They are ideal for creating tall and dramatic floral arrangements and are often used for special occasions such as weddings and formal events.

Urn vases are characterized by their wide and rounded shape, resembling an urn or a vase used in ancient times. They are often used for displaying large bouquets of flowers or for creating grand floral arrangements.

Made from clay, terracotta vases have a rustic and earthy appeal. They are often used for displaying dried flowers or as decorative pieces in gardens or outdoor spaces.

These are just a few examples of the many types of vases available. The choice of vase depends on the intended use and the style of the space it will be placed in.

Vase materials

Vases can be made from a wide range of materials, each offering its own unique characteristics and aesthetic appeal. Some of the most popular materials used to make vases include:

Glass vases are a timeless classic and are loved for their transparency and ability to showcase the beauty of the flowers within. They come in a variety of shapes and sizes, from sleek and modern designs to intricately cut crystal vases that add a touch of luxury to any space.

Ceramic vases are versatile and come in a wide range of styles and designs. They can be glazed or left unglazed, and often feature intricate hand-painted patterns or textures. Ceramic vases are durable and can withstand both indoor and outdoor environments.

Metal vases, such as those made from brass, copper, or stainless steel, add a touch of industrial chic to any space. They are often used as statement pieces and can be adorned with intricate engravings or embossed designs.

Porcelain vases are known for their delicate and translucent appearance. They are often handcrafted and decorated with intricate patterns or painted designs. Porcelain vases add a touch of elegance and sophistication to any space.

Wood vases are loved for their natural and organic appeal. They can be made from a variety of woods, such as teak, mahogany, or bamboo, and often feature unique grain patterns or carved details. Wood vases add warmth and texture to any interior.

These are just a few examples of the materials used to make vases. The choice of material depends on the desired style, durability, and aesthetic preferences.

How to choose the right vase?

Choosing the right vase for your space can enhance the overall aesthetic and create a harmonious balance. Here are some tips to consider when selecting a vase; for example, the size of the vase should be proportional to the space it will be placed in. A large vase may overpower a small table, while a small vase may get lost in a large room. Consider the scale and dimensions of the space to determine the appropriate size.

The style of the vase should complement the overall decor of the room. For a modern and minimalist space, opt for sleek and streamlined designs. For a more traditional or eclectic space, consider decorative vases with intricate patterns or ornate details. The color of the vase should harmonize with the color palette of the room. You can either choose a vase that complements the existing colors or one that contrasts to create a focal point. Consider the flowers or foliage that will be displayed in the vase and how they will interact with the surrounding colors. The shape of the vase can greatly influence the overall aesthetic. Consider the style and form of the flowers or foliage that will be displayed in the vase. A tall and narrow vase may be suitable for long-stemmed flowers, while a wide and open vase may be more appropriate for a lush bouquet.

Lastly, you can think about how the vase will be used. If you plan to display fresh flowers, choose a vase with a wide opening that can accommodate a variety of stems. If you prefer dried flowers or artificial arrangements, consider vases with a narrower opening or unique shapes that enhance the visual appeal.

By considering these factors, you can choose a vase that not only complements your space but also enhances the beauty of the flowers or foliage within.

How to decorate with vases?

Vases offer endless possibilities for creative and eye-catching displays. Whether it’s on your coffee table or your buffet, combining and adding vases to your home decoration is a lovely way to truly express yourself and add that “something special” to your home.

There are many different ways to create a composition with your vases; such as clustering them together and creating a stunning centrepiece by grouping vases of different sizes and shapes. Mix and match materials and heights for added visual interest. Fill each vase with a single stem or a small bouquet of complementary flowers.

You can also have a monochrome display; creating a striking display by choosing vases in the same colour or material but in different shapes and sizes. Arrange them in a geometric pattern or asymmetrically for a modern and minimalist look.

You can fill glass vase models with water and float a single flower or a few petals on the surface, to give the flower or the petals a floating look. This simple yet elegant display adds a touch of tranquility and beauty to any space.

Terrarium vases are miniature gardens, created by filling a glass vase with layers of soil, moss, rocks, and small plants. This unique and low-maintenance display adds a touch of greenery to any room.

Flowers are seasonal, so you can also change up your vase displays according to the seasons. In spring, fill a vase with blooming cherry blossoms or tulips. In summer, opt for vibrant wildflowers or sunflowers. In autumn, go for dried branches or colorful foliage. And in winter, fill a vase with evergreen branches or pinecones.

These are just a few ideas to get you started. The possibilities for decorating with vases are endless, so let your creativity flow and experiment with different arrangements and styles.

How to clean and maintain vases?

Proper care and cleaning of your vases will ensure their longevity and keep them looking their best. Here are some tips to help you care for your vases: Regularly clean your vases with warm soapy water and a soft sponge or cloth. Avoid using abrasive cleaners or scrub brushes, as they can scratch or damage the surface of the vase.

For stubborn stains or residue, soak the vase in a mixture of warm water and white vinegar. Let it sit for a few hours or overnight, then rinse with clean water and dry thoroughly.

If your vase has a narrow opening that is difficult to clean, try using a long-handled bottle brush or a mixture of rice and warm soapy water. Swirl the mixture around in the vase to remove any dirt or residue, then rinse with clean water.

When displaying fresh flowers, change the water every few days to prevent bacterial growth and keep the flowers fresh for longer. Trim the stems at an angle before placing them in the vase to ensure they can absorb water properly. If using a metal or glass vase, be careful when handling to avoid accidental breakage or injury. Place a soft cloth or mat underneath the vase to protect the surface it is placed on. By following these simple care and cleaning tips, you can keep your vases looking beautiful and ensure they last for years to come.
